Cleaning Tips

Inexpensive Ways to Keep it Clean
  • To remove scuff marks on vinyl floors: cut a hole in a tennis ball and put it on the end of a broomstick and rub over marks.
  • To get spotless windows and mirrors without chemicals: use a solution of water and regular vinegar (abut 1/2 cup of vinegar to 2 cups of water); spray and wipe.
  • Dust with a paintbrush to get to those hard-to-reach door jambs.
  • To reduce the smell of trash in small wastebaskets: fill wastebasket with about 1/2 cup of dry potpourri mixture. Replenish as needed.
  • Clean ceramic tile with a solution of 1/4 cup of baking soda; 1/2 cup white vinegar and 1 cup of ammonia to one gallon warm water. Be sure to wear rubber gloves as this solution is harsh.
  • To clean a microwave, boil a solution of 1/4 cup of vinegar and 1 cup of water in the microwave. It will loosen splattered-on food and deodorize.
  • To deodorize the kitchen drain, pour a cup of baking soda down the drain once a week. Flush with hot water.
  • To keep your refrigerator smelling fresh, dampen a cotton ball with vanilla flavoring and place in the back corner of your fridge. It soaks up the smell a fridge can sometimes get.
  • Out of toilet bowl cleaner? Drop in two Alka Seltzer tablets, wait 20 minutes, brush and flush.
